Clinical Details

Clinical and radiological findings:  Young man with a history of fall on the palm of the hand. 2 days old injury. His x rays showed a fracture dislocation of his wrist. Volar Barton fractures are intra-articular ones and they need anatomical reduction and stable fixation. So that early rehabilitation could be started as stiffness is a major issue with hand and wrist.
